Understanding Video Copyright Verification Fundamentals

Video copyright verification is the systematic process of confirming whether a video or its components (audio, visual elements, footage) are protected by copyright law and determining who holds the legal rights to use that content. This verification process has become increasingly sophisticated as digital content proliferation has made copyright infringement more common and easier to commit inadvertently.

What Makes Video Copyright Complex

Unlike text-based content, videos contain multiple copyrightable elements that require separate verification:

- Visual footage: The actual video recording or animation

- Audio tracks: Background music, sound effects, and voiceovers

- Embedded graphics: Logos, text overlays, and visual effects

- Performance rights: Appearances by actors or public figures

- Derivative works: Content based on existing copyrighted material

How Video Copyright Check Tools Work

Modern video copyright check online platforms utilize advanced technologies to scan and identify copyrighted material:

Content ID Systems: These algorithms create digital fingerprints of videos by analyzing audio waveforms, visual patterns, and metadata. When you upload a video, the system compares its fingerprint against massive databases of registered copyrighted content.

Metadata Analysis: Verification tools examine embedded information within video files, including creator details, timestamps, and licensing information that can reveal copyright ownership.

Audio Recognition: Specialized algorithms identify copyrighted music, even when it's been modified in pitch, tempo, or mixed with other audio elements.

Key Takeaway: Comprehensive video copyright verification requires checking multiple layers of content simultaneously. A video might pass visual verification but fail due to copyrighted background music. Always use a video copyright check tool that examines all components—audio, visual, and metadata—to ensure complete compliance before publishing or distributing your content.

Common Copyright Verification Scenarios

Content creators typically need verification in these situations:

1. Pre-publication checks: Before uploading content to platforms

2. Licensing validation: Confirming purchased licenses are legitimate

3. Dispute resolution: Proving ownership when challenged

4. Content acquisition: Verifying rights before purchasing stock footage

5. Platform compliance: Meeting requirements for monetization eligibility

For Businesses and Marketing Teams

Corporate video content requires stringent verification to protect brand reputation and avoid costly litigation. Marketing departments should implement verification at multiple stages:

Pre-Production Phase: Before creating content, verify that stock footage, music libraries, and graphics have proper commercial licenses. A copyright checker integrated into your content management workflow prevents issues before they start.

Third-Party Content Review: When working with freelancers or agencies, verify that delivered content doesn't contain unauthorized copyrighted material. Request documentation proving all elements are properly licensed.

Website Content Audits: Regularly scan video content on your website using a video copyright check online service. This proactive approach identifies potential violations before copyright holders issue DMCA takedown notices.

⚠️ Warning: Platform-specific copyright rules vary significantly. A video approved for YouTube might violate TikTok's policies, and vice versa. Facebook's Rights Manager has different thresholds than Instagram's copyright detection. Always verify content against each platform's specific requirements and use platform-appropriate verification tools. Remember that fair use claims rarely protect commercial content, regardless of transformation or commentary added.

Do's and Don'ts of Copyright Verification

Do:

- Verify content before uploading, not after receiving a strike

- Keep records of licenses, permissions, and verification results

- Use multiple verification methods for high-value content

- Educate your team about copyright basics and DMCA compliance

- Invest in reputable video copyright check tool subscriptions

Don't:

- Assume "no copyright intended" disclaimers provide legal protection

- Rely solely on platform detection systems for verification

- Skip verification for short clips or background elements

- Use content just because others are using it without consequences

- Ignore copyright claims hoping they'll disappear
